FLORIDA POWER DEVELOPMENT is a 125 MW coal power plant in Hernando County, FL, operated by FLORIDA POWER DEVELOPMENT. Hernando County carries elevated modeled catastrophe exposure in the FEMA National Risk Index, scoring 3.2 of 5 at the 55th national percentile. Hurricane is the leading peril, rated Relatively High by FEMA at the 92nd percentile.

The Bywatts loss layer is calibrated to solar PV hardware, so it is not applied to a coal plant. The ratings below are the FEMA National Risk Index county hazard ratings for this location.
